Hello,
we're building an ASIL-B System using the S32K142. We've licensed the SCST to get the required diagnostic coverage for the core. Any download option on the NXP website as well as the actual licenses at the official distributors only make a difference between M0 and M4 core. However after having purchased the license and downloading the "official" library, many places in the documentation exclusively refer to the S32K144, e.g.

  • the filename of the downloaded archive is SCST_M4_S32K144_RTM
  • The release notes .txt file often refers to S32K144. One line mentions that S32K14x are support, but the next line says, the library was only tested with S32K14.
  • the user manual ("M4_S32K144_SCST_User_Manual", Rev 1.5 / Feb 27th 2020) says in section 1.3 that only the S32K144 is a supported device.
    • as an add-on question: also in this document, three compilers are listed as "supported". Does this exclude the SCST from being used with other compilers? We were planning to use the ARM compiler V6 ,which is also safety certified.

Other documents like the Safety Manual, Test specification or safety concept (all date back to 2017) don't refer to any specific controller models.

Can you please explain the reason for this inconsistency and confirm if the downloaded SCST version is fully compatible with the S32K142, both from a technical point of view as well as from a formal / documentation / test coverage, etc. point of view.

The package supports all S32K14x family members because they share the same core as S32K144 which was used for testing, all the artifacts are also applicable to the family members

Thanks Martin.

It would be great if the documents could be updated some time in the future to avoid this type of confusion in future.

Do you also have a statement on the question about the compiler? What's the implication of using a different compiler than one of the three mentioned in the documentation (i.e. the ARM compiler in our case)?

The mentioned specific compilers & versions are used for the product testing and thus we guarantee the functionality when theses compilers are used. If another compiler version is used, e.g. a newer one, typically we do not expect any issue, but still it is a customer responsibility to use. If another compiler is used (from another vendor) then mostly it will not work easily. The customers can approach the NXP sales/marketing to request a specific compiler/version support as a paid service.
